  • @hemlock399
    @hemlock399 Год назад +5

    This crazy song has 8 highly distinct movements in less than 3 1/2 minutes. I call it "heavy jazz", especially the first movement, which I didn't like at first. The song is now one of my all-time faves.
    The transitions are just insanely good, & I especially enjoy the transitions from 6 to 7 & 7 to 8. Section 7, with its bluesy vocal lines & open instrumental feel coming right off of a blast beat, is my very favourite...but it's important to realize that part of the reason it's so satisfying to listen to is its position within the song.
    What masterful a work of art.
    "Ape" Movements:
    1. The Beginning of All Beginnings (begins 0:07).
    2. Voracious Ape Who Walks Upright (begins 1:01).
    3. He Who Calls Himself Intelligent (begins 1:15).
    4. I Made a Mistake When I Created You (begins 1:33).
    5. Oh Here You Go (begins 1:43).
    6. Blast (begins 2:09).
    7. Just the Mention of Your Name (begins 2:22).
    8. Bloodthirsty Ape Who Walks Upright (begins 2:52).
